The trouble code p0341 is set when the camshaft position sensor (cmp) signal is out of expected range or if it is not timed properly with the crankshaft position sensor. The camshaft sensor enables the engine control to determine the exact position of the crankshaft drive. Diagnostic procedures for this code typically start with checking the sensor’s wiring harness for any signs of damage or corrosion.
